YRKKH 10th June 2025 Written Update: Abhira’s Friend. Today in Yeh Rishta Kya Kehlata Hai written update, Saris, Secrets & a Missing Maira: When Udaipur’s Drama Hits Full Throttle.

The episode begins with the sari showdown in full swing. Kaveri and Vidya try the food like it’s MasterChef Udaipur, while Kajal and Manisha cheer them on like it’s a food festival. Meanwhile, Tanya spots a sari she likes, and Krish—playing the overly eager fiancé—tells her to go ahead and take it. All good, until Manisha throws shade harder than a solar eclipse, whispering to Kaveri and Vidya that Krish has chosen a girl with no brains. Subtlety? Never heard of it.

Krish walks into the chaos and is stunned to see his personal “No Entry” list—Manisha and Kajal—hanging out with Kaveri and Vidya. He instantly loses his cool and yells at them for joining what he sarcastically calls their “stupid business.” Tanya tries to damage-control and reminds Krish that the media is watching (because nothing says classy like public bickering at a social event). She quietly decides to take the sari and make a stylish exit.

Krish, attempting to save face, offers to pay for the sari, but Kaveri turns into the embodiment of dignified refusal. She insists it’s a gesture to make up for the missed engagement gift. But Krish’s ego refuses to back down—he says he doesn’t accept gifts from those not on his “level” and hands over the money like he’s doing charity. Cue eye-rolls all around.

Anshuman, in true chivalrous style, calls out Krish for his arrogance and tells him to apologize to Kaveri. Krish, still in ego-mode, says he doesn’t have time for drama. Anshuman fumes, but Abhira steps in and thanks him for standing by Kaveri. Sparks fly, and they both begin to warm up to each other. Kaveri quietly smiles—probably shipping them already.

Cut to Maira’s mood spiral. She’s devastated about not qualifying for the finals… until the host announces she has actually qualified. Plot twist powered by bad editing or just dramatic suspense? Either way, Maira celebrates the only way she knows—by demanding ice cream like a true queen.

Abhira buys herself some ice cream too, and Armaan (yes, with the extra ‘a’—finally spelled right!) spots her at the cultural fest. The man practically drowns in his own nostalgia. He watches her silently, debating whether to approach her. He touches her shoulder, and Abhira senses something—but the big confrontation doesn’t happen yet. Armaan’s torn between Abhira and Maira, muttering about how he can’t lose Maira now. Mixed signals much?

Maira senses something’s off with Armaan and tries to get him to open up. Armaan decides to bolt back to Mount Abu. Maira objects, and their little soap opera continues until Geetanjali shows up, revealing she brought Maira without Armaan’s permission. He loses his temper. Maira, emotionally bruised, lets go of his hand and storms off… and then goes missing. Classic TV move.

Armaan panics. For a guy who just said he couldn’t lose Maira, he sure let her disappear in record time. Geetanjali scolds him for being careless, and now it’s full-blown panic mode.

Elsewhere, Maira, now walking alone, hails an auto. But of course, the driver takes a shady turn, and Maira realizes she’s in danger. She bolts out and runs for her life. Coincidentally, Kaveri, Vidya, and Abhira are taking a leisurely walk on the same road (because dramatic rescues only happen when women take unplanned strolls). Abhira sees a stack of boxes and gets a flashback—because apparently, cardboard trauma is real.

She investigates, and lo and behold, they find Maira hiding in the boxes. Surprise reunion, but with a side of fear and questions.

Episode ends.

YRKKH 10th June 2025 Written Update Precap:

Armaan and Geetanjali frantically try to find Maira. Geetanjali asks the golden question—how does Armaan plan to find her in Udaipur, and does he even know anyone here? Maira, meanwhile, drops a bomb on Abhira by revealing that Geetanjali is her mother. Abhira is left shocked, and we’re left waiting for more fireworks.
